logo

Output 8bcc613317e02ca1a1648f63a46117764be3d93630cfa4aefebe41843e8112bc:3

value
1258897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ea2c4fd8e504445e457f7001efd860efcdecd5ea OP_EQUAL
address
3P3D8H2P3YVXqeEu42bP389J8J5e1ZdPdD
transaction
8bcc613317e02ca1a1648f63a46117764be3d93630cfa4aefebe41843e8112bc